1989 Opel Corsa vs. 1966 Suzuki Fronte
To start off, 1989 Opel Corsa is newer by 23 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1966 Suzuki Fronte.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1966 Suzuki Fronte would be higher. At 993 cc (4 cylinders), 1989 Opel Corsa is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1989 Opel Corsa (44 HP @ 5400 RPM) has 9 more horse power than 1966 Suzuki Fronte. (35 HP @ 4000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1989 Opel Corsa should accelerate faster than 1966 Suzuki Fronte.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1989 Opel Corsa weights approximately 10 kg more than 1966 Suzuki Fronte.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1966 Suzuki Fronte (81 Nm @ 3500 RPM) has 13 more torque (in Nm) than 1989 Opel Corsa. (68 Nm @ 2600 RPM). This means 1966 Suzuki Fronte will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1989 Opel Corsa.
Compare all specifications:
1989 Opel Corsa | 1966 Suzuki Fronte | |
Make | Opel | Suzuki |
Model | Corsa | Fronte |
Year Released | 1989 | 1966 |
Engine Size | 993 cc | 785 cc |
Horse Power | 44 HP | 35 HP |
Engine RPM | 5400 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Torque | 68 Nm | 81 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2600 RPM | 3500 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 4 seats |
Number of Doors | 3 doors | 3 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 770 kg | 760 kg |
Vehicle Length | 3630 mm | 3880 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1540 mm | 1490 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1370 mm | 1370 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2350 mm | 2250 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 70 L | 66 L |
